Vibe coding explained: Plus 7 AI coding tools to get started

In February 2025, the former co-founder of Openai Andrej Karpathy published a tweet It would start a revolution in the coding and the development of software. Yes, we are talking about “ambient coding”, a term that has since spread on the internet as forest fires. Even the latest GPT-5 model from Openai aims to please the atmosphere coding fanatics.
So what is this new coding method?
Coding of the atmosphere 101
The practice of room coding, by Karpathy, is simply to use AI to do your coding for you. For example, you will find an idea, then say to the AI to code it. From there, you review the code, and all the modifications or corrective that you wanted would be returned via the AI again and again until everything is correct.
This tweet is currently not available. It can be loaded or has been deleted.
The coder does not need to do real coding; Instead, they use natural language to describe the code, the website or the application they want to create. The feeling of letting preconceived concepts go and letting AI manage everything is described as “fully yielding to vibrations” by karpathy. Any change suggested by AI is automatically accepted and reduced in the code. No thoughts, just vibrations.
He met champions and detractors. On the one hand of the fence, people like karpathy have fully adopted the capacity of AI to write code and let AI do the bulk of the work, content to explore what AI can and cannot do on its external fringes. Others have in derision of practiceTo say that the code created in this way is often incomprehensible and unpredictable, and that good engineers include their own code.
How can I get into the coding of the atmosphere?
It’s honestly quite easy to do. If you have access to an AI chatbot, you can start coding atmosphere immediately. You will want to make sure you are going there knowing what to be done. For example, many have suggested that you have a strong and clear vision of what your code wants to do before entering it, so that AI writes a better code. Here is a decent tutorial Through the mood coding.
If you want to train with training wheels, Google has recently introduced Opal, a kind of paint atmosphere coding by number. You can see what others have created and use models to start.
What are the best room coding tools?
Almost all modern LLMs are decently adapted to the coding of atmospheres. All have knowledge of code at the heart of the product. Even IA companies use LLM to code things, as has been shown when Anthropic Cut Openai Access to APIs At the beginning of August. However, if you are completely new in this area and you want ideas on where to look for, here are some good tools to try the mood coding.
We recommend that you pay attention, make backups and save your work. The coding of the atmosphere can go wrongleading to the deletion of your code.
Code Claude
Code Claude is a wonderful place to start for the mood coding. It is a variant of the Chatbot Claude d’Anthropic which is optimized specifically for coding. We were impressed by the latest anthropic models, Claude 4, in particular for coding work.
Claude Code works specifically in integrated development environments (IDE) such as VS code while being able to modify several files at a time. He also has integrated protections so as not to modify your code without your expressed consent, which helps to avoid problems such as deleting code that we mentioned earlier. Of course, if you have never heard of an IDE before, we recommend that you start with a more suitable atmosphere coding tool, such as GPT-5 or Google Opal.
Mashable lighting speed
Using Claude, more advanced room coders can import existing code, which AI can then read and summarize. According to Anthropic, the AI can make small modifications such as bug corrections or greater modifications such as the implementations of the functionality, which make it good for mood coding. Others LLM of big names like Google Gemini work very well for that too, but Claude Code is specifically built for this kind of thing, it is therefore a more natural option.
GPT-5

Credit: Ian Moore / Mashable Composite; I opened
We have already mentioned the other large dogs, but GPT-5 Gets a special mention because it is new. Openai published the model on August 7, and with regard to advanced intelligence, this is a good choice. In addition to being the last model on the market, Openai has thought about the side of things, which we will talk about.
One of the great highlights of the version is the improvements in the agent coding, which is a technological appearance to be able to code things according to the invites in natural language. Openai demonstrated this during his livestream with good results. Our technological publisher also gave him a chance, and we found him for people with zero Coding experience, GPT-5 is an excellent ambient coding tool for beginners. It is a great push for atmosphere coding fans, and it is surprisingly easy to use.
Cursor
Cursor is another good choice for the coding atmosphere for the same reason as Claude Code. It is an ide with a chatbot I integrated, and as such, the mood coding is at the top of its features list. This is one of the AI tools that we have seen most often recommended, and it is quite easy to get started without much previous experience.
The large draw for the cursor is his coding agent. You can tell him to make changes, and that will do it while telling you what changes it brings. This maintains the coders in the loop so that they know what to ask for then. It can also do things like automatic bug corrections to reduce the amount of effort you need to spend and iteratizing. Like Claude Code, you can also import libraries to use for documentation, giving you the opportunity to personalize your coding.
Kind
Kind is just up there with the cursor as an option that we considered to be recommended quite often. It works roughly the same way as the cursor, where you can speak to Bot AI so that your code is written while requiring changes, bug corrections, etc. It also has common features such as importing code for documentation and other things like that.
Like competition, Lovable has various integrations that you can add to make your life easier, including access to the API to Openai and Anthropic, as well as Github. So, with a little effort, you can integrate the things necessary to give you the performance you need. Lovable focuses more on the rapid side of the AI, but the cursor is a more traditional IDE. You should therefore choose that we vibe (word game) better with your style.
V0 by Vercel
V0 by Vercel is the final tool that we recommend to check. It works very well for ambient coding and seems to be specifically built for such a thing. You tell him what you want and it generates a web application that does what you ask. However, like 21ST.DEV, it seems that people want to create user interface elements alongside the software, which achieves a good all-in-one program for room coding.
Like others on the list, you have a list of integrations you can add to increase the probability of success with your work. It can be integrated directly into Grok, for example, and the coders can add their API keys for others like Openai and Anthropic. When looking for this article, I found that many people recommend using it with something like Claude Code as a punch for a room coding.
Honorable mention: OPAL by Google

Credit: Google
As we mentioned earlier, Google recently launched Opal, a ambient coding tool that allows you to take advantage of a variety of other Google IA tools, such as Imagen, Gemini and even Veo, the Google generator video generator. Although you are limited in the types of applications and websites that you can create, this tool adapted to beginners does not require any experience of programming or software development. In our tests, the interface facilitates understanding the functioning of your application. While working, Opal creates a visual connection network so that you can see how each step fits overall.
Honorable mention: 21st.dev
21ST.DEV is not a tool that you would use to vibrate the code. However, this is something you would use next to ambient coding. The idea is that it helps you build a user interface for your program. You can then vibrate the code and use the user interface elements manufactured here to create a cohesive application. The service works mainly on the modules that you can then export and use in your existing code.
These components give you some ideas for the model for a user interface that you can then modify and build your specifications using the AI chatbot. So, for example, you can use This apple liquid glass button Component, then modify it with the AI to make it appear and do what you want. You can then import this code into your project, which makes the user interface a lot.
Leave the AI
By testing all these products, I appreciated the fact that I have practically no knowledge of modern coding, and I could still create simple stuff fairly quickly. I guess it is the advantage of atmosphere that has been theiest of someone who has not touched an idea since 2008.
In all cases, the ambient coding in its current form has months, so more tools are published all the time to take advantage of the last coding mode. Keep an eye on new AI coding tools in the coming months.
Disclosure: Ziff Davis, Mashable’s parent company, in April, filed a complaint against Openai, alleging that it has violated Ziff Davis Copyrights in the training and exploitation of its AI systems.
Subjects
Chatgpt artificial intelligence




